What do you know about Robert E. Lee?Robert Edward Lee served as a Confederate general during the American Civil War and was later named the overall commander of the Confederate States Army. Robert Edward Lee (January 19, 1807 – October 12, 1870) was a Confederate general. From 1862 until the Confederacy's capitulation in 1865, he served as the commander of the Army of Northern Virginia, the most potent army in the Confederacy, and developed a reputation as a shrewd tactician.
Lee was a distinguished commander and military engineer in the United States Army for 32 years. He was the son of Revolutionary War officer Henry "Light Horse Harry" Lee III. He provided service all around the country, made a significant contribution during the Mexican–American War, and served as the superintendent of the United States Military Academy. He wed great-granddaughter Mary Anna Custis Lee.

90 POINTS PLEASE HELP WITH MY SHORT ANSWER QUESTION FOR 90 POINTS IT IS NOT MULTIPLE CHOICE DONT ANSWER A B OR C, YOU HAVE TO ANSWER ALL THREE
Answer all parts of the question that follows.
a) Identify ONE way in which the development of new technologies in the twentieth century changed the global economy.
b) Explain ONE similarity in how the development of new medical innovations and agricultural technologies in the twentieth century affected the environment.
c) Explain ONE major change in global culture in the late twentieth century.
Answer:
a) Identify ONE way in which the development of new technologies in the twentieth century changed the global economy.
The assembly line, invented by Henry Ford in the early twentieth century, changed the global economy throughout that century, because it allowed firms to standardize the production of a wide range of goods, from automobiles, to canned food, to clothing, making production more efficient and cheaper for the consumer in the process.
b) Explain ONE similarity in how the development of new medical innovations and agricultural technologies in the twentieth century affected the environment.
Both medical innovations like vaccines and agricultural technologies like the green revolution helped boost population growth, because more people could be fed, and less people died in childhood. This population growth created more pressure on the environment, and led to the climate change challenges that we face today.
c) Explain ONE major change in global culture in the late twentieth century.
In the late twentieth century, television first, and then the internet, became global means of communication that helped spread local cultures around the world. This changed local cultures, and made them more global, because now the world was more interconnected, and intercultural change became easier.

The Bretton Woods Conference helped develop the World Bank and the International Monetary Fund (IMF). Why was America concerned with making sure that European countries received money?
Answer:
To make European countries buoyant enough to be an important market for American exports.
Explanation:
The Bretton Woods Conference, which was carried out in 1944, was made to promote international trade while maintaining the independent policy goals of separate nations.
However, during the early years around 1946 to 1948 of its implementation, the European countries were running balance-of-payments shortages, leading to an increase in immediate need of their dollar and gold reserves.
Because of this situation, the United States felt that European countries wouldn't buy their goods as exports if they don't have money.
Hence the reason America was concerned with making sure that European countries received money is "to make European countries buoyant enough to be an essential market for American exports."

In one to two paragraph, describe some of the advantages and disadvantages of using credit cards.
PLZZZZZZZ HELP!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!
Answer:SORRY if this is too much i tried
Advantages of using credit cards
There are many advantages when using a credit card as a method for purchasing goods. It does not necessarily mean that you do not have funds to cover those purchases. The use of a credit card, instead of cash or personal funds, offers the following advantages:
Building credit history.
A quick source of funds in an “absolute” emergency
No accrued interest if bill is paid on time and in full each month
Zero liability as consumers is not responsible for fraudulent charges when reported promptly.
Consumer protection ($50.00) if fraudulent charges are reported promptly in case the card is stolen or lost.
Disadvantages of using credit cards
Along with the advantages listed above, the use of credit cards can also have several disadvantages:
Established credit-worthiness needed before getting a credit card
Encouraging impulsive and unnecessary “wanted” purchases
High-interest rates if not paid in full by the due date
Annual fees for some credit cards – can become expensive over the years
Fee charged for late payments
Negative effect on credit history and credit score in case of improper usage
